Summary
A vulnerability classified as problematic has been found in Pilz PMC Programming Tool up to 3.5.16. Impacted is an unknown function. This manipulation causes weak password hash. The identification of this vulnerability is CVE-2020-12069. There is no exploit available. It is recommended to upgrade the affected component.
Details
A vulnerability has been found in Pilz PMC Programming Tool up to 3.5.16 and classified as problematic. Affected by this vulnerability is some unknown processing. The manipulation with an unknown input leads to a weak password hash vulnerability. The CWE definition for the vulnerability is CWE-916. The product generates a hash for a password, but it uses a scheme that does not provide a sufficient level of computational effort that would make password cracking attacks infeasible or expensive. As an impact it is known to affect confidentiality. The summary by CVE is:
In Pilz PMC programming tool 3.x before 3.5.17 (based on CODESYS Development System), the password-hashing feature requires insufficient computational effort.
The weakness was shared 12/27/2022 as VDE-2021-061. It is possible to read the advisory at cert.vde.com. This vulnerability is known as CVE-2020-12069 since 04/22/2020. The technical details are unknown and an exploit is not publicly available. The attack technique deployed by this issue is T1552 according to MITRE ATT&CK.
Upgrading to version 3.5.17 eliminates this vulnerability.
